        Yeah, yeah. There are few folks so adept at tooting their own horn
as I am, but the truth is I did not have the foggiest notion what I was
looking at and fully expected Dave and Mary Ann to tell me it was "just
a...". If I had been alone none of you would have ever heard of this bird
and it would have gone into the mental files as another bird at Conowingo I
could not identify (there are hundreds). It was Mary Ann, or Dave, or both,
who first raised the possibility that this was a Slaty-backed, a bird I
have neevr seen and wouldn't know if it landed on me. Enough of this
already...it was at best a cooperative effort (and that gives me more
credit than I deserve). And it was Dave who, while we were watching the
bird. suddenly said "HOLY (typical birder expletive deleted), that's a
CALIFORNIA GULL next to it!" That was a moment that'll stick with me a
while.
